Jacobs
4 Embarcadero Center Suite 3800, San Francisco, CA 94105, USA
+1 415-356-2040
http://www.jacobs.com/
(3 reviews)
Engineering Design Technology – Oakland, CA
2019 Powered By WordPress Alpha By WordPress Alpha Blog